This talk gives an overview of the recent development in the study of non-perturbative fermion-boson vertex in quenched QED towards achieving that the fermion propagator satisfies the Ward-Takahashi identity, is multiplicatively renormalizable, agrees with perturbation theory for weak couplings and has a critical coupling for dynamical mass generation that is strictly gauge independent. The use of such a vertex may lead to a realistic calculation of t(tbar) condensates as the source of electroweak symmetry breaking. (Talk given at The Advanced Study Institute on Frontiers in Particle Physics, Cargese, Ajaccio, France, August 1-13, 1994.)
